Precision Manufacturing - CNC Engineer - Jaffrey, NH
My client is seeking a CNC Engineer to spearhead the development of a highly technical precision hard turn and hone process. This role combines project management, process development, and hands-on engineering to deliver improved manufacturing efficiency and product performance.
Client Details
A global leader in precision manufacturing, my client is known for producing high-quality, mission-critical components for aerospace and industrial applications. They operate with a strong focus on engineering excellence, innovation, and continuous improvement.
Description
Responsibilities:
- Lead research, design, and implementation of new CNC hard turning processes.
- Develop methods to improve precision and reduce distortion through advanced techniques.
- Plan, schedule, and communicate project milestones and deliverables.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to resolve technical issues and drive improvements.
- Provide leadership, training, and technical expertise to team members as needed.
- Support capital project justification through ROI analysis.
- Drive workplace organization and 6S practices to improve efficiency.
Profile
Ideal Candidate:
- Bachelor's degree in Mechanical, Industrial, Electrical Engineering, or related discipline.
- 5+ years of experience in a manufacturing environment.
- Strong background in CNC machining, hard turning, and project management.
- Skilled in AutoCAD/SolidWorks, MS Access, and Excel.
- Highly proficient in blueprint reading, engineering drawing interpretation, and tolerancing.
- Demonstrated problem-solving ability, detail orientation, and communication skills.
- Prior experience leading cross-functional teams and managing technical projects.
